Summary: Pagers used by Hezbollah, an armed group, to communicate dramatically burst almostsimultaneously across the country on Tuesday, inflicting thousands of injuries. There were about2,800 injuries, many of them serious, and at least nine fatalities. Although Israel is Hezbollah’s enemy, it is unknown how the attack, which appears to have beenvery sophisticated, happened. So far, no official comments have been made by Israeli officials.Where and when did it happen? The explosion started in Beirut, the capital of Lebanon, on Tuesday at approximately 15:45 (localtime) (13:45 BST). The explosions also happened in numbers in various other parts of the nation.Witnesses said they saw…

Myanmar Floods :More than 220 people have perished in Myanmar as a result of Typhoon Yagi , and approximately80 more are still unaccounted for, according to the military government.Over 500 people have died as a result of the typhoon that hit areas of Vietnam, Laos, Thailand,and Myanmar in early September, according to official statistics.Typhoon yagi caused extreme flooding and mudslides in Myanmar, destroying entirecommunities and resulting in atleast 220 fatalities. The UN issued a warning, noting thathundreds of thousand of acres of crops had been devastated and that over half a million peoplein the war-torn Nation urgently needed basic amenities…

In the parts of Central Europe, Devastating Floods are causing havoc. As StormBoris’s deluge of rain continues to wreak havoc over Central and Eastern Europe, oneperson has drowned in Poland and one firefighter has perished during a river rescue inAustria. Five persons have passed away in Romania, and numerous more in the CzechRepublic are still missing.The leaders of the Austrian province that encircles Vienna have referred to “anunprecedented extreme situation” and proclaimed it a disaster area. Donald Tusk, theprime minister of Poland, announced one death on Sunday while pleading with theaffected citizens to assist rescuers.Four people are still unaccounted for…

The United States, along with Lithuania, have expressed concerns regarding China’s “continuedprovocative, destabilizing, and intimidating activities” in the South China Sea. The statement wasreleased jointly following the meeting with US Deputy Secretary of State Kurt Campbell andLithuanian foreign minister Gabrielius Landsbergis in Vilinus on September 12.People from both nations welcomed Lithuania’s concern and their efforts to further strengthenor robust economic partnership with Taiwan and to further support meaningful participation inthe international forum of Taiwan. The joint statement from Foreign Minister Lands and Deputy Secretary Campbell was released by Landsbergis and Campbell.
